Хотя возможно, что что-то было удалено, у меня был опыт, что что-то напортачило в файле проекта. Мне еще предстоит выяснить, что это за «что-то». У меня были похожие проблемы, когда установка SDK прошла нормально. Есть несколько вариантов.
Сначала добавьте все ваши файлы в новый проект. Кажется, это обычно работает. Вид боли, хотя.
Во-вторых, вы можете щелкнуть правой кнопкой мыши по проекту в XCode / Get Info / Build / Library Search Paths. Добавьте новые пути, похожие на /Developer/Platforms/iPhoneSimulator.platform/Developer/SDKs/iPhoneSimulator3.1.sdk/usr/lib. Добавьте соответствующие версии этой строки для каждой версии (2.2.1 и т. Д.) И платформы (симулятор или iPhoneOS). Выполните аналогичное действие для Путей поиска в фреймворке, если фреймворки - ваша проблема.
В-третьих, более трудоемким, но более надежным является открытие project.pbxproj из MyProject.xcodeproj (Textmate хорошо для этого). Найдите раздел «/ * Начать XCBuildConfiguration * /», затем «LIBRARY_SEARCH_PATHS» и «FRAMEWORK_SEARCH_PATHS». Добавьте или измените пути соответствующим образом и сохраните файл.
В любом случае, боль в заднице, и я бы точно хотел указать причину, потому что у меня такое было пару раз. Проект строится нормально, потом просто работает и отказывается делать это, как кажется, мало оснований.